Liderkit Group closes 2014 with a growth in its turnover of 12% and a growth forecasting of 22% for 2015

9 Apr 2015 | Press, News

Liderkit Group has ended 2014 with a growth of 12% in its turnover in comparison to the previous year and the company has estimated a growth forecasting of 22% for 2015. Furthermore, in comparison to the last 5 years, this company has increased its revenue a 27% compared to the revenue reached in 2009.

Specially significant is the sales increase achieved over the last five years by Liderkit Group in the market of France, Germany and Belgium, with a positive development of 120%, 42% and 36% respectively. According to Juan de la Cruz Villar, Commercial Director of Liderkit Group, “the export is one of the main pillars of Liderkit Group, even though we estimate a growth of 38% in 2015 for the national market in comparison to the sales volume of 2014.

In this sense, Liderkit Group has just entered the Australian market, a country where it had not operated before. The company has disembarked in the Australian state of New South Wales, whose capital city is Sidney, where Liderkit Group has commercialized nine plywood kits and one sandwich kit with its respective chassis and floors, which have been loaded in a shipping container and which are already travelling on the roads of Australia.
